Aktualizujte všechna pole ve Wordu pomocí Python REST API

Podle tohoto článku aktualizujte všechna pole v DOC pomocí Python REST API. Naučíte se jak aktualizovat pole ve Wordu pomocí Python Low Code API pomocí Cloud SDK založené na Pythonu. Bude ukázán úplný proces, počínaje načtením zdrojového souboru aplikace Word a nakonec stažením aktualizovaného souboru aplikace Word z cloudového úložiště.

Předpoklad

Kroky k aktualizaci pole ve Wordu pomocí Python RESTful Service

  1. Vytvořte instanci objektu Configuration nastavením tajného klíče klienta a ID pro aktualizaci polí
  2. Vytvořte objekt WordsApi pomocí výše uvedené konfigurace
  3. Načtěte zdrojový soubor aplikace Word do datového proudu paměti s některými daty pole, jako je TOC
  4. Vytvořte třídu UpdateFieldsOnlineRequest a vytvořte požadavek na načtený soubor aplikace Word
  5. Vyvolejte metodu UpdateFieldsOnline() pomocí výše uvedeného objektu požadavku
  6. Analyzujte odpověď API a získejte přístup k vrácenému streamu
  7. Uložte výstupní proud jako soubor na disk

Výše uvedené kroky vysvětlují jak aktualizovat všechna pole ve Wordu pomocí Python REST API. Načtěte zdrojový soubor aplikace Word do datového proudu paměti, vytvořte objekt požadavku, definujte název cílového souboru a zavolejte metodu UpdateFieldsOnline() k aktualizaci polí. Analyzujte výsledný proud v dokumentu odpovědí a uložte jej jako soubor na disk.

Kód pro automatickou aktualizaci polí ve Wordu pomocí Python REST API

Tento ukázkový kód ukazuje, jak aktualizovat pole aplikace Word v souboru aplikace Word. Můžete aktualizovat obsah, křížové odkazy, čísla stránek a pole data a času. Když nastavíme název cílového souboru, vrácený objekt dokumentu obsahuje odpověď se stejným názvem, aby se odlišil od ostatních souborů v cloudovém úložišti.

Můžete se také podívat na další funkci na následující stránce: Extrahujte text z dokumentu Word pomocí Python REST API.

 Čeština